Pressure cleaning services involve the use of high-pressure water streams to remove dirt, grime, mold, algae, and other stubborn debris from various surfaces. This method effectively restores the appearance of exterior surfaces such as driveways, sidewalks, decks, fences, and building exteriors. The process can be tailored with different pressure levels and nozzles to suit specific materials, ensuring that surfaces are cleaned thoroughly without damage. Many service providers also incorporate specialized cleaning solutions to enhance results on certain surfaces like brick, concrete, or wood.

These services are particularly valuable for addressing common problems associated with outdoor surfaces. Over time, accumulated dirt, moss, and algae can lead to staining, surface deterioration, and safety hazards such as slippery areas. Pressure cleaning helps eliminate these issues, reducing the risk of damage caused by organic growth or embedded grime. Regular cleaning can also extend the lifespan of exterior surfaces by preventing the buildup of corrosive substances and maintaining their structural integrity.

The overview below groups typical Pressure Cleaning proj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Nassau County, FL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Pressure Cleaning Cost - Typically ranges from $150 to $400 for residential properties, depending on the size and surface type. Larger or more complex projects may cost more, sometimes exceeding $500.

Per Square Foot Pricing - Many service providers charge between $0.15 and $0.50 per square foot. For example, cleaning a 2,000 sq ft driveway could cost between $300 and $1,000.

Commercial Pressure Cleaning - Commercial properties often see costs between $500 and $2,500, influenced by the scope of the project and the building's size. Large or multi-story buildings may incur higher fees.

Additional Services - Extra services like surface sealing or stain removal can add $100 to $300 or more. These costs vary based on the specific treatments needed and the extent of work required.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What surfaces can be cleaned with pressure washing? Pressure cleaning is effective on surfaces such as driveways, sidewalks, decks, fences, and building exteriors.

Is pressure cleaning suitable for all types of siding? It is generally suitable for many siding materials, but it is best to consult a local professional to ensure proper technique and safety.

How often should pressure cleaning be performed? The frequency depends on the surface and environmental conditions; a local contractor can recommend a suitable schedule.

Does pressure cleaning remove stains and grime? Yes, pressure washing effectively removes dirt, stains, algae, and grime from various surfaces.

Are there any surfaces that should not be pressure cleaned? Delicate surfaces such as certain types of wood or aged materials may require alternative cleaning methods; a local expert can advise accordingly.
